The Atlanta Falcons obliterated the San Francisco 49ers in a 41-13 rout, making it the second time this season they’ve scored 40 points in back-to-back games.
Let’s revisit the top three matchups from the game.
Falcons run defense versus Carlos Hyde and Colin Kaepernick
Atlanta’s run defense held Hyde to 71 yards on the ground — a week after he posted 193 yards. Admittedly, Hyde perhaps could’ve done more with more touches. He had 13 as the 49ers were forced to pass 33 times since they were in a 21-0 hole almost immediately.
Kaepernick had just three rushes for 21 yards. Vic Beasley being used as a spy likely had a lot to do with that.
Devonta Freeman and Tevin Coleman versus the 49ers defense
San Francisco’s defense against the run was as bad as advertised. Freeman went off for 139 yards and three touchdowns, Coleman finished with 58 yards on 14 carries, and even third-string running back Terron Ward put up 52 yards. With Matt Ryan’s -1 yard rush, the Falcons totaled 249 on the ground.
Taylor Gabriel versus the 49ers defense
It was more of the same for Gabriel as he caught three passes for 60 yards and a score. He’s now found the end zone in six of the Falcons’ past seven games. Here’s another opportunity to thank our friends in Cleveland.
